It can be done via two paths (to my knowledge):
1) Merge events can alter the value with arx file format.
2) Direct SQL to the "H" table.
Hints:
Option #1) Do a report to arx with Field 1 and the Status-History
field. You will need to pay special attention to the control
characters that are used as separators in that ascii(ish) file.
Option #2) If you know SQL you likely will need almost no help. But
... if you do not know SQL then see option #1. :)
